Moisture and End Up Quality
Humidity considerably impacts the finish high quality of industrial paint tasks. When humidity levels are high, moisture in the air can disrupt the drying out process of paint. This can result in issues like inadequate bond, irregular finishes, and enhanced drying out times.
You might discover that your paint takes longer to treat, which can postpone your job timeline.
On the other hand, reduced moisture can additionally pose issues. If the air is too completely dry, paint can dry too promptly, avoiding appropriate leveling and resulting in a harsh surface. You desire your paint to stream efficiently, and quick drying can impede that, leaving you with an unacceptable surface.
To attain the very best surface, aim for humidity degrees in between 40% and 70%. This variety enables optimum drying out problems, ensuring that the paint adheres well and levels out correctly.
Consider utilizing dehumidifiers or fans to regulate wetness in indoor projects, and attempt to plan exterior tasks for days when humidity is within the excellent variety. By focusing on moisture, you can improve the final appearance and toughness of your business paint job.
Wind and Outdoor Conditions
While you mightn't consider wind as a major variable, it can substantially influence the result of outdoor business paint jobs. High winds can interrupt your application process, causing paint to dry also rapidly. When paint dries out also fast, it can bring about an unequal surface or noticeable brush strokes.
You'll additionally face challenges with paint overspray, as wind can bring fragments far from the intended surface area, leading to squandered materials and prospective damages to bordering areas.
In addition, strong gusts can create security risks on the job site. Ladders and scaffolding are extra susceptible to tipping in gusty conditions, putting your staff in danger. It's essential to monitor wind rates prior to starting a task. If winds exceed risk-free restrictions, it's finest to postpone your work to make certain a quality coating and keep safety.
On calmer days, you can make use of the best conditions to achieve smooth, professional outcomes. Always examine the weather forecast and plan accordingly.
